WFW acts for Grupo T-Solar on photovoltaic plant deals

Watson Farley & Williams (WFW) advised solar power producer Grupo T-Solar on the acquisition of three operating photovoltaic solar plants in Spain from multiple sellers.

 

The three plants – located in Badajoz, Seville and Toledo – have a combined installed capacity of 5.6 megawatts.

The acquisition means T-Solar has a portfolio of 392 megawatts of installed capacity.

The WFW team was led by Madrid managing partner María Pilar García Guijarro (pictured), and included associates Fernando Santos and Daniel Refoyo.
